Simultaneous temperature and refractive index sensor based on a tilted fibre Bragg grating

摘要

Optical device based on a tilted fibre Bragg grating (TFBG) to perform simultaneous measurement of refractive index (RI) and temperature is proposed. Using two different demodulating techniques, namely monitoring the core mode wavelength and the area of the transmission spectrum, it is possible to measure, separately, temperature and RI, respectively. The proposed method uses a grating, which does not require a reduced diameter, and a single measurement equipment. Measurements with resolution up to 5.7 × 10~(-4) and 0.5 °C were achieved, for RI and temperature, respectively. Theoretically, the resolution of RI measurements can go as bellow as 2 × 10~(-5).
